I trained in Brazil in 2011 when I did my study abroad there. I’m sure the sport had grown immensely but at the time my Brazilian friends from university said that BJJ was not very popular because it was associated with sort of thuggish and homophobic behavior from the late 90s and early 2000’s. They basically told me not to tell people I trained 😅

You’re correct. But I also work on having my sternum directly above their sternum for all passes.

Knee cut, smash pass, half guard, I want to be over them so if they go to frame their arms are bench pressing me and are perpendicular to the ground and their shoulders are flat on the mat.

It also means they can’t really creat an angle without letting me pass.
